Taking care of things is a short film from 1951 released on 16mm. It is held in the IUL Moving Image Archive collection.
Explains the importance of caring for one's toys, clothing, and other property. Emphasizes having definite places to keep things, putting articles back where they belong, cleaning up after playtime, and storing and handling things properly to prevent...
